Handover — Vexhall image cache leak

For security review. Leak confirmed in the Vexhall thumbnail cache: evicted entries keep GPU texture handles alive, RSS climbs ~40MB/hr under load. Patch in branch cache-evict-fix; not merged pending your sign-off on the new unsafe block in the eviction path. Repro script in the Norbeck test harness. Heap dumps archived in the sealed evidence vault — you'll need to unseal it to inspect them. The vault prompt expects the recovery passphrase given on the next line.

vault phrase of tajeg-tageg = pelix-druix-holius-briael-zorwyn-frawyn-fraox-norok-drueth-aldiel

## Tuning cold starts

Quick notes for the sync: the Dabbler handlers were cold-starting in the 3–4s range because we eagerly loaded the whole Fernwick schema registry. We now lazy-load and keep a small warm pool. If latency spikes again, bump the pool before touching anything else. The knobs we actually adjust live in the constants below.

limits module of fajog-tawig:
RATE_LIMITS = {
    "druwyn": 2,
    "quenael": 10,
    "wenix": 2,
    "druael": 2,
}

TURN-208: Gatevale turnstile counters at the Merrow Field pilot double-count when a rotation reverses mid-cycle. Attendance totals drift roughly 2% high per event. The debounce window fix is implemented, reviewed by Ilsa, and soak-tested across two simulated match days without drift. Ready for your cut; the candidate build is identified below.

trace token, tagag-tafog: htk6_5ed18c

[ ] Verify GraphQL N+1 query fix for Fernbright's member directory. Before this release, each profile card triggered a separate lookup for badge data, causing slow loads on large orgs. The fix batches badge lookups via a dataloader. Support should confirm that directory pages with 200+ members now load in under two seconds and that badge counts still match the admin panel. If a customer reports stale badges, escalate to the Orchard team. The build token for this release follows.

build token for kagaf-hahof: htk14_9d3d4d26d7d8de